CBRT-Property prices rose by 14 pct. in real terms annually

NEWS IN ENGLISH

Residential property prices increased by 1.5 percent on monthly basis, in November, according to the Residential Property Price Index data, released by the Central Bank of the Republic of Turkey (CBRT) on Tuesday.


Residential property prices increased by 30 percent in nominal terms and 14 percent in real terms in November on an annual basis.

The Residential Property Price Index (RPPI) (2017=100), which measures quality-adjusted price changes of dwellings in Turkey stands at 152.2 in November 2020 by a monthly increase of 1.5 percent

The residential property prices increased monthly by 1.7 percent in all three major cities: İstanbul, Ankara, and İzmir, in November. İstanbul, Ankara, and İzmir recorded an annual increase of 27.8, 30.1, and 29.9 percent respectively, over the same period.
